2 resultados para Lattice-based cryptography
em Digital Commons - Michigan Tech
Resumo:
Three-dimensional flow visualization plays an essential role in many areas of science and engineering, such as aero- and hydro-dynamical systems which dominate various physical and natural phenomena. For popular methods such as the streamline visualization to be effective, they should capture the underlying flow features while facilitating user observation and understanding of the flow field in a clear manner. My research mainly focuses on the analysis and visualization of flow fields using various techniques, e.g. information-theoretic techniques and graph-based representations. Since the streamline visualization is a popular technique in flow field visualization, how to select good streamlines to capture flow patterns and how to pick good viewpoints to observe flow fields become critical. We treat streamline selection and viewpoint selection as symmetric problems and solve them simultaneously using the dual information channel [81]. To the best of my knowledge, this is the first attempt in flow visualization to combine these two selection problems in a unified approach. This work selects streamline in a view-independent manner and the selected streamlines will not change for all viewpoints. My another work [56] uses an information-theoretic approach to evaluate the importance of each streamline under various sample viewpoints and presents a solution for view-dependent streamline selection that guarantees coherent streamline update when the view changes gradually. When projecting 3D streamlines to 2D images for viewing, occlusion and clutter become inevitable. To address this challenge, we design FlowGraph [57, 58], a novel compound graph representation that organizes field line clusters and spatiotemporal regions hierarchically for occlusion-free and controllable visual exploration. We enable observation and exploration of the relationships among field line clusters, spatiotemporal regions and their interconnection in the transformed space. Most viewpoint selection methods only consider the external viewpoints outside of the flow field. This will not convey a clear observation when the flow field is clutter on the boundary side. Therefore, we propose a new way to explore flow fields by selecting several internal viewpoints around the flow features inside of the flow field and then generating a B-Spline curve path traversing these viewpoints to provide users with closeup views of the flow field for detailed observation of hidden or occluded internal flow features [54]. This work is also extended to deal with unsteady flow fields. Besides flow field visualization, some other topics relevant to visualization also attract my attention. In iGraph [31], we leverage a distributed system along with a tiled display wall to provide users with high-resolution visual analytics of big image and text collections in real time. Developing pedagogical visualization tools forms my other research focus. Since most cryptography algorithms use sophisticated mathematics, it is difficult for beginners to understand both what the algorithm does and how the algorithm does that. Therefore, we develop a set of visualization tools to provide users with an intuitive way to learn and understand these algorithms.
Resumo:
Traditional transportation fuel, petroleum, is limited and nonrenewable, and it also causes pollutions. Hydrogen is considered one of the best alternative fuels for transportation. The key issue for using hydrogen as fuel for transportation is hydrogen storage. Lithium nitride (Li3N) is an important material which can be used for hydrogen storage. The decompositions of lithium amide (LiNH2) and lithium imide (Li2NH) are important steps for hydrogen storage in Li3N. The effect of anions (e.g. Cl-) on the decomposition of LiNH2 has never been studied. Li3N can react with LiBr to form lithium nitride bromide Li13N4Br which has been proposed as solid electrolyte for batteries. The decompositions of LiNH2 and Li2NH with and without promoter were investigated by using temperature programmed decomposition (TPD) and X-ray diffraction (XRD) techniques. It was found that the decomposition of LiNH2 produced Li2NH and NH3 via two steps: LiNH2 into a stable intermediate species (Li1.5NH1.5) and then into Li2NH. The decomposition of Li2NH produced Li, N2 and H2 via two steps: Li2NH into an intermediate species --- Li4NH and then into Li. The kinetic analysis of Li2NH decomposition showed that the activation energies are 533.6 kJ/mol for the first step and 754.2 kJ/mol for the second step. Furthermore, XRD demonstrated that the Li4NH, which was generated in the decomposition of Li2NH, formed a solid solution with Li2NH. In the solid solution, Li4NH possesses a similar cubic structure as Li2NH. The lattice parameter of the cubic Li4NH is 0.5033nm. The decompositions of LiNH2 and Li2NH can be promoted by chloride ion (Cl-). The introduction of Cl- into LiNH2 resulted in the generation of a new NH3 peak at low temperature of 250 °C besides the original NH3 peak at 330 °C in TPD profiles. Furthermore, Cl- can decrease the decomposition temperature of Li2NH by about 110 °C. The degradation of Li3N was systematically investigated with techniques of XRD, Fourier transform infrared (FT-IR) spectroscopy, and UV-visible spectroscopy. It was found that O2 could not affect Li3N at room temperature. However, H2O in air can cause the degradation of Li3N due to the reaction between H2O and Li3N to LiOH. The produced LiOH can further react with CO2 in air to Li2CO3 at room temperature. Furthermore, it was revealed that Alfa-Li3N is more stable in air than Beta-Li3N. The chemical stability of Li13N4Br in air has been investigated by XRD, TPD-MS, and UV-vis absorption as a function of time. The aging process finally leads to the degradation of the Li13N4Br into Li2CO3, lithium bromite (LiBrO2) and the release of gaseous NH3. The reaction order n = 2.43 is the best fitting for the Li13N4Br degradation in air reaction. Li13N4Br energy gap was calculated to be 2.61 eV.